Lee Wei Ling clarifies that she did not retract entire post regarding new law on Contempt of Court
http://www.theonlinecitizen.com/2016/08 ... -of-court/


In the post she said she had written a letter to the Straits Times in 2008 to speak out against a sentence for former CK Tang head Tang Wee Sung. He was sentenced to a day after he had tried to buy a kidney illegally.

Lee had help wording the letter from two lawyers from Allen and Gledhill, Lucian Wong and K Shanmugam (who is now the Law and Home Affairs Minister). She said that both lawyers “encouraged and supported” her to write the letter. She also said that “now being on the side of the government, Minister Shanmugam seems to see justice only from the point of view of the government and the AGC always being right.”
